烟台物联网水质检测解决方案及stm32单片机电控模块设计

行业资讯 admin 发布时间:2025-07-22 浏览:6 次

烟台物联网水质检测解决方案及stm32单片机电控模块设计

随着互联网技术的发展和智慧城市的推进, 物联网在环境监测、智能交通等领域的应用越来越广泛。本方案基于烟台地区的具体需求,结合最新的STM32单片机开发技术和ESP8266无线通信模组,为水质检测物联网系统提供了一套完整的解决方案。

该方案旨在通过部署分布式的传感器网络实现对城市河流、湖泊的实时监测, 并及时将数据传输至云端服务器进行分析处理。下面详细描述了系统的功能模块及其技术选型:

一、水质检测物联网系统概述

(烟台)该方案主要由前端传感器节点和后端云服务平台两部分组成,其中前端负责收集环境数据, 后台则完成数据分析展示等功能。

  • 前端: 采用STM32单片机作为控制核心,集成各类水质检测传感器(如PH值、溶解氧等)
  • 通信模块:ESP8266无线模组实现与云端的连接
  • (烟台)后端平台:基于阿里云IoT套件构建, 提供数据存储和可视化功能。

二、系统详细设计说明:

1. 水质传感器节点:

  • 采用高精度的电化学水质检测仪,可测量PH值等参数。通过SPI接口与STM32单片机连接, 实现数据采集功能。

(烟台) 2. STM32控制模块:

  • 开发基于FreeRTOS的操作系统内核以提高系统的实时性;使用HAL库简化硬件操作流程,加快项目进度。
  • 4G模组和Cat1通信技术的集成, 实现数据传输功能。选择这一方案是考虑到其广泛的网络覆盖范围以及较低的成本优势。(烟台)

(烟台) 3. (ESP8266无线模块):

  • 支持TCP/IP协议栈,能够直接与云服务器建立连接, 并将采集到的数据上传至云端。
  • LuatOS系统开发技术应用:, 支持Lua脚本语言编写应用程序逻辑,并且具有良好的跨平台兼容性。(烟台)

(烟台) 4. 后端云服务:

  • 使用阿里IoT套件提供的MQTT协议实现数据传输;通过规则引擎处理接收到的数据并存储至数据库中。
  • AWS Lambda函数开发技术:, 实现对上传到S3桶中的传感器日志进行分析,进而生成报告供用户查看。(烟台)

三、(物联网)系统功能介绍:

(1. 数据采集与处理:前端节点定时读取水质参数,并通过无线模块发送给云端服务器。)

  • MQTT协议:, 作为数据传输的标准,确保了设备间通信的安全性和高效性。

2.(数据分析展示)功能:

(云平台接收到的数据经过预处理后, 在Web界面上以图表的形式显示给用户。)

  • Django框架:, 用于开发后台管理系统,提供数据查询和管理等功能。

四、(烟台)技术难点分析及应对策略:

(1. 如何保证传感器节点在恶劣环境下的稳定运行?)

  • Air7模组:, 选用具备防水防尘特性的通信模块, 提升系统可靠性。

2.(如何实现数据的安全传输?)

(使用TLS/SSL协议加密,确保上传至云端的数据不被截获。)

  • TLS1.2:, 作为最新的安全通信标准, 提供了强大的保护机制。

五、(烟台)项目开发周期及人员配置建议:

(根据系统复杂程度,预计需要3-6个月完成全部功能的研发工作。)

  • 硬件工程师:, 负责传感器节点的电路设计和调试。
  • MQTT协议专家:, 专注于云平台的数据通信机制研究与实现。(烟台)

(欢迎咨询陈经理:18969108718,微信同号。我们将为您提供最专业的技术咨询服务!)

在线咨询

点击这里给我发消息售前咨询专员

点击这里给我发消息售后服务专员

在线咨询

免费通话

24h咨询:18969108718


如您有问题,可以咨询我们的24H咨询电话!

免费通话

微信扫一扫

微信联系
返回顶部